THE MOLECULAR BASIS OF SELECTIVITY OF NUCLEOTIDE TRIPHOSPHATE INCORPORATION OPPOSITE O6-BENZYLGUANINE BY SULFOLOBUS SOLFATARICUS DNA POLYMERASE IV: STEADY-STATE AND PRE-STEADY-STATE AND X-RAY CRYSTALLOGRAPHY OF CORRECT AND INCORRECT PAIRING
About this Structure
2JEF is a [Single protein] structure of sequence from [Sulfolobus solfataricus] with CA and DGT as [ligands]. Active as [DNA-directed DNA polymerase], with EC number [2.7.7.7]. Structure known Active Site: AC1. Full crystallographic information is available from [OCA].
